The Providencia Group is Hiring a Case Review Specialist Near Rio Grande, TX

TITLE: Case Review Specialist
LOCATION: Arizona, Florida, and Texas
TRAVEL: Required, potentially extensive at times, based on project need(s)

About The RoleThe Case Review Specialist (CRS) will be responsible for submitting cases for release approval from our government client. CRS must have knowledge of case management and specifically within the Office of Refugee Resettlement (ORR) field.
What You’ll Do
  • Review case summaries and release requests submitted by Unification Specialists (US) to ensure they are in alignment with policy and procedures for a safe and efficient reunification
  • Responsible for sending back any incomplete or incorrect cases for Unification Specialist to revise and resubmit.
  • Identify any trends in reason or staff in cases being sent back to the Case Review Manager
  • Submit release request for their assigned cases
  • Regularly reviews and updates the company case management tracking system and government case management tracking system
  • Ensure US staff is following proper procedures and ORR policy at all times.
  • Report any issues with their assigned cases to the Lead Case Review Specialist as well as the Lead Unification Manager.
  • Identifies violations of company’s and client’s policies and ensures small corrections are made by the appropriate Unification Specialist and more complex issues are raised to the Lead Case Review Specialist and Lead Unification Manager to be addressed and/or corrected.
  • Duties are performed via a government approved computer system. Employees are required to possess strong computer skills in MS Word and Excel.
  • Perform related duties as assigned, within your scope of practice.
Key SkillsWhat we’re looking for
  • Bachelor’s degree in Social Work / Psychology, Sociology or other relevant Behavioral Science.
  • ORR Experience - Two (2) years’ experiences as a Case Manager supporting ORR Case Management.
  • Bilingual in Spanish and English.
  • Requires advance knowledge of Microsoft Office Suite, to include Word, Excel, MS Teams, and Outlook.
  • Must type 45 wpm
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ills
  • Attention to detail
  • Available to work the preset schedule. Schedules are subject to change due to changes in the operations. Employees will be required to work some Holidays
Travel Requirements
  • You will be required to complete 2 weeks of training to include webinars and in-person sessions on-site, Temporary Duty Travel (TDY)
  • The ability to travel is mandatory – All Case Manager/Unification Specialists are required to support a TDY assignment on-site for a minimum of 30-days, with the option for the company to extend in 30-day increments
  • Additional travel assignments may be required based on project need, though program leadership will attempt to minimize travel by assigning tasks to those Case Manager/Unification Specialists who reside closest to the site where a support need exists
  • Tasks/assignments are dynamic and will change based on client needs and resource availability, meaning Case Managers/Unification Specialists are expected to provide additional administrative support, including the completion of data entry and intake paperwork, as required
  • Potential to support some home office work, based on project need and workload. This option is only available if you are not required to support a contract within close proximity to your home or required to TDY
Work Schedule
  • Due to the importance of this position, employees supporting this contract may be required to work extended hours including evening work, support on-call assignments, and work weekends to support time-sensitive or real-time complex services
  • This position is considered ESSENTIAL – Case Manager/Unification Specialists are required to report and work during emergencies or crises, including inclement weather, natural and man-made disasters, etc.
